lib/yext/api/concerns/account_relations.rb in yext-api-0.1.4 vs lib/yext/api/concerns/account_relations.rb in yext-api-0.1.5
- old
+ new
@@ -24,9 +24,17 @@
# KnowledgeApi::AccountSettings
has_many :users, class_name: "Yext::Api::KnowledgeApi::AccountSettings::User"
has_many :roles, class_name: "Yext::Api::KnowledgeApi::AccountSettings::Role"
+ # KnowledgeApi::OptimizationTasks
+ has_many :optimization_tasks,
+ class_name: "Yext::Api::KnowledgeApi::OptimizationTasks::OptimizationTask",
+ uri: Yext::Api::Concerns::AccountChild.with_account_path("optimizationtasks/(:id)")
+ has_many :optimization_links,
+ class_name: "Yext::Api::KnowledgeApi::OptimizationTasks::OptimizationLink",
+ uri: Yext::Api::Concerns::AccountChild.with_account_path("optimizationlink")
+
# LiveApi
has_many :live_locations, class_name: "Yext::Api::LiveApi::Location"
end
class_methods do